Understanding Stablecoins
Stablecoins are digital assets designed to maintain a relatively stable value by referencing another asset, most commonly the United States dollar. Unlike cryptocurrencies that may experience significant price fluctuations, stablecoins aim to provide consistency, making them suitable for payments, settlements, savings, and commercial transactions.
Their stability allows businesses and individuals to benefit from blockchain technology without facing the same level of price volatility associated with many other digital assets.
Today, stablecoins are widely used across centralized exchanges, decentralized finance platforms, international payment systems, and digital asset ecosystems.
Their practical nature has made them one of the fastest-growing segments of the cryptocurrency industry.

Cross Border Payments Are Changing
International payments have traditionally required multiple intermediaries, resulting in higher costs and longer settlement times.
Stablecoins introduce an alternative model.
Transactions can often be completed much more efficiently using blockchain networks.
Businesses conducting international trade may benefit from faster settlement.
Individuals sending funds internationally may experience improved accessibility.
Global commerce increasingly values speed, transparency, and operational efficiency.
Stablecoins support these objectives by providing programmable digital money capable of moving across blockchain networks with greater flexibility.
As international business continues expanding, demand for efficient payment solutions is likely to increase.
